Gemma Buddle and Damien Martin
A PLYMOUTH couple took a two-week honeymoon to Taba Heights in Egypt following their June wedding.
A traditional church service at St Mary's in Tamerton Foliot saw Gemma Buddle and Damien Martin become husband and wife on Saturday, June 19.

Guests joined them at Boringdon Hall in Colebrook, for the reception.
Gemma, wearing a champagne coloured dress with strapless bodice, simple veil and tiara, was walked down the aisle by her father, Leon Buddle.
She carried a "beautiful" bouquet of white roses and green foliage and was attended by friends, Danielle Eyre and Laura Ward.
They wore simple but elegant emerald green, v-neckline dresses with cream wraps and carried smaller versions of Gemma's bouquet.
Bridegroom Damien had friend Richard Channing as his best man.
Damien is the only son of Terry and Susan Martin, of Somersham, Cambridge. Gemma is the only daughter of Leon and Janice Buddle, of Derriford.
The couple met at work three years ago and Damien proposed down on one knee.
Bride Gemma, said: "The weather was gorgeous. The groom became so emotional at the service, it was very touching, and he became emotional at the speeches. There were a lot of tears from him.
"On the evening, we had the first dance then after the first dance we also had a father and daughter dance."
